As a Measure Developer uploading deemed load shape 8760s, I want to see which Impact Profiles were generated, updated, or reused so that I can understand what impact profiles were generated or failed, and identify any existing impact profiles that were replaced.
Following a load shape upload and Impact Profile generation, Measure Developers currently have limited visibility into what processing occurred.
Users cannot easily determine:
Which Impact Profiles were newly generated
Which Impact Profiles failed to generate
If possible why they failed to generate
Which IOU AC territories and climate zones were impacted
Whether existing Impact Profiles were replaced by the upload
This lack of transparency makes it difficult for users to validate processing outcomes, troubleshoot issues, and understand the downstream impacts of their uploads.
The summary should support partial success scenarios where some Impact Profiles generate successfully while others fail.
Processing failures should only roll back the affected Impact Profiles and should preserve any unrelated or previously existing data.

Introduce an Impact Profile generation summary, using the existing Claims QC Summary pattern as the UX model, to provide users with clear visibility into processing outcomes.
The summary should display:
Impact Profiles successfully generated
Existing Impact Profiles updated
Existing Impact Profiles reused with no changes
Impact Profiles that failed to generate
Associated IOU service territories
Associated climate zones
